Amazing New House In London Hotel
Located 3.4 km from Holland Park, Amazing New House In London Hotel is 6 minutes' stroll from Kensal Rise Seventh Day Adventist Church.
Location
Situated within 7 km of Buckingham Palace, the guest house also gives access to such sports venues as Wembley Stadium, which is 4.5 km away. The property stands within a short walking distance of Kensal Green tube station. This London hotel stands 10 minutes by car from BAPS Shri Swaminarayan Mandir London, popular with pilgrims and tourists alike. The accommodation is near London Kensal Green train station, around 400 metres away.
Rooms
Staying at one of the 6 rooms at Amazing New House In London Hotel, guest have access to a dining area. Guests can take advantage of a separate toilet and a shower, along with a hair dryer and bath sheets supplied in the bathrooms.
Food & Drinks
Dining options also include Delicias UK, situated about 5 minutes' walk away.
Amenities
Amazing New House In LondonParking options
- Parking
In the kitchen
- Electric kettle
- Cookware/ Kitchen utensils
In the rooms
- Dining table
Important information
Enter dates to see availability